What companies run services between Chepstow, Wales and Rennes, France?

You can take a train from Chepstow to Rennes via Birmingham New Street, London Euston, London St Pancras Intl, Paris Nord, Gare du Nord, Montparnasse Bienvenue, and Paris Montparnasse 1 Et 2 in around 8h 42m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Chepstow Bus Station Stand 2 to Rennes - Bus Station via London Victoria Coach Station Arrivals, London Victoria, Dover, Paris, Quai de Bercy (Bercy Seine), and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station in around 18h 15m.
